Summary
Scott Workinger is a seasoned educator and entrepreneur based in Redwood City, California, with a Ph.D. in Engineering from Stanford University. He is the founder of Workinger Consulting, specializing in custom course development and systems engineering. With over two decades of experience, Scott has held leadership positions, including President of the Silicon Valley Chapter of the International Council of Systems Engineering (INCOSE). His expertise spans architecture, systems thinking, and problem analysis, making him a valuable asset in the engineering and educational sectors. Scott's innovative approach to teaching integrates design thinking and integrative methods to address complex challenges. He previously founded Teambridge, a startup focused on collaboration software, showcasing his entrepreneurial spirit. Scott is passionate about transforming educational experiences and solving "wicked" problems in engineering.
